Eva Pharma
EVA Pharma is a multinational pharmaceutical company headquartered in Egypt with more than a century of corporate history. The company operates multiple manufacturing facilities and research centres in the Middle East and Africa, reports producing ~1,000,000 packs daily, maintains a portfolio of ~300 marketed products with several hundred more in development, and states capabilities across small-molecule and biologics manufacturing, clinical and pre-clinical research, and regional distribution and partnerships.

Products
Apixaban (apixaban 5 mg) - anticoagulant product
Oral anticoagulant indicated for stroke and systemic embolism prevention in non-valvular atrial fibrillation, and treatment/prevention of DVT and PE.
Armodafinil (Armodafinil 50 mg) - wakefulness agent
Treatment of excessive sleepiness associated with obstructive sleep apnea, narcolepsy, or shift work sleep disorder.
Gabapentin (Gabapentin 300 mg) - neuropathic pain
Oral gabapentin product indicated for neuropathic pain.
Favipiravir (Favipiravir 200 mg) - antiviral
Antiviral oral formulation for treatment of certain influenza virus infections when other agents are ineffective.
Selected additional products (examples)
Examples from the product portfolio across therapeutic areas: etoricoxib for inflammatory conditions, perindopril+amlodipine for hypertension, fluticasone for allergic rhinitis, silodosin for BPH, L-carnitine formulations for deficiency states, alfacalcidol for calcium metabolism disorders.
